Subject: [PATCH net-next 06/14] sctp: do the basic send and recv for PLPMTUD probe

This patch does exactly what rfc8899#section-6.2.1.2 says:

   The SCTP sender needs to be able to determine the total size of a
   probe packet.  The HEARTBEAT chunk could carry a Heartbeat
   Information parameter that includes, besides the information
   suggested in [RFC4960], the probe size to help an implementation
   associate a HEARTBEAT ACK with the size of probe that was sent.  The
   sender could also use other methods, such as sending a nonce and
   verifying the information returned also contains the corresponding
   nonce.  The length of the PAD chunk is computed by reducing the
   probing size by the size of the SCTP common header and the HEARTBEAT
   chunk.

Note that HB ACK chunk will carry back whatever HB chunk carried, including
the probe_size we put it in; We also check hbinfo->probe_size in the HB ACK
against link->pl.probe_size to validate this HB ACK chunk.
